April 29, 2025
Navigating the Cloud Service Lifecycle
8 min read
Cloud technology is revolutionizing how businesses operate. With global spending on cloud services expected to soar to $723.4 billion in 2025, mastering the cloud service lifecycle is more crucial than ever. But here's the twist: many organizations focus solely on adoption without truly understanding how to manage these services effectively. This lack of strategy can lead to wasted resources and missed opportunities. The real game changer lies in knowing how to optimize each phase of the cloud service lifecycle, ensuring your organization not only keeps up but thrives in this digital age.
Quick Summary
Takeaway | Explanation |
---|---|
Understand Cloud Service Lifecycle Phases | Familiarize with the phases of strategy, design, transition, operation, and continuous improvement to effectively manage cloud services and maximize value throughout their life. |
Implement Automation for Operational Efficiency | Leverage automation for provisioning, backups, and monitoring to enhance efficiency, reduce human error, and allow teams to focus on strategic tasks. |
Establish a Clear Cloud Optimization Strategy | Align cloud initiatives with business goals and adopt data-driven methods to identify optimization opportunities, ensuring cost efficiency and resource alignment. |
Focus on Continuous Improvement and Feedback | Regularly review performance data and user feedback for ongoing enhancements, establishing a feedback loop that informs all lifecycle phases. |
Adopt a Collaborative Approach to Cost Management | Implement FinOps practices that foster collaboration among finance, tech, and business teams to ensure accountability and optimize resource usage. |
Understanding Cloud Service Lifecycle
The cloud service lifecycle represents the complete journey of a cloud service from its inception to retirement. This structured approach ensures organizations maximize value while minimizing risks throughout a service's existence. Let's explore the fundamental aspects of this critical framework that shapes modern IT operations.
Core Phases of Cloud Service Lifecycle
The cloud service lifecycle typically consists of several distinct yet interconnected phases. Each phase serves a specific purpose in ensuring the service delivers value efficiently.
Strategy and Planning: Every successful cloud service begins with clear objectives. During this initial phase, organizations define what the service will accomplish, who it will serve, and how it aligns with broader business goals. This planning stage involves stakeholder input, requirement gathering, and preliminary cost analysis.
The design phase follows, where architects create the technical blueprint for the service. This includes determining the appropriate cloud deployment model (public, private, hybrid), selecting providers, and designing security protocols. Proper design decisions here prevent costly adjustments later.
Implementation transforms designs into functioning services. This phase involves provisioning resources, configuring environments, and establishing monitoring systems. According to the Application Lifecycle Framework, organizations must carefully manage the transition from on-premises systems to cloud environments during this phase, focusing on evaluation, planning, migration, and operation strategies.
Once deployed, the service enters operations mode. This maintenance phase includes monitoring performance, addressing issues, applying updates, and ensuring security compliance. Cloud Storage Object Lifecycle Management plays a critical role here, allowing teams to automate storage resource management by defining rules for actions like storage class transitions or object deletions based on specific criteria.
The optimization phase involves continuous improvement through performance analysis and cost management. Finally, retirement occurs when the service no longer delivers sufficient value relative to its cost or has been superseded by newer solutions.
Management Approaches and Tools
Effective lifecycle management requires both strategic frameworks and practical tools. The Service Management API offers a declarative model for programmatic service management, enabling teams to push immutable service configurations and control rollouts to achieve desired service states.
Modern organizations increasingly adopt Infrastructure as Code (IaC) practices to automate provisioning and configuration. This approach treats infrastructure elements as software components, making them repeatable, version-controlled, and less prone to human error.
Continuous Integration/Continuous Deployment (CI/CD) pipelines automate testing and deployment processes, reducing the time between development and production while maintaining quality standards. These systems integrate with monitoring tools that provide real-time insights into service health and performance.
Financial management tools track cloud spending across the lifecycle, identifying optimization opportunities and preventing cost overruns. These solutions help maintain the balance between performance and financial efficiency.
Also read: Top 98 DevOps Tools to Look Out for in 2025
Challenges and Best Practices
Navigating the cloud service lifecycle presents several challenges. Service interdependencies create complex relationships that must be managed carefully. When one service changes, it may affect numerous others, requiring coordination across teams.
Security and compliance requirements evolve continuously, demanding vigilant monitoring and adaptation throughout the lifecycle. Organizations must implement security by design rather than as an afterthought.
Cost management becomes increasingly complex as services scale. Without proper controls, cloud spending can quickly exceed budgets. Implementing right-sizing practices and scheduled resource reviews helps control these costs.
To address these challenges, successful organizations establish clear governance frameworks that define roles, responsibilities, and decision-making processes across the lifecycle. They implement automated testing at all stages to catch issues early when they're less expensive to fix.
They also maintain comprehensive documentation that evolves with the service, ensuring knowledge transfer even as team members change. Finally, they create feedback loops that capture insights from each phase to improve future iterations.
By understanding and effectively managing the cloud service lifecycle, organizations can maximize service value while minimizing risks and costs, turning cloud technology from a useful tool into a strategic advantage.
Key Lifecycle Stages Explained
Let's dive deeper into each stage of the cloud service lifecycle to understand how they work together to create a cohesive management framework. According to cloud service management experts, there are five fundamental stages that form the backbone of effective cloud service management.
Service Strategy
The service strategy phase establishes the foundation for all cloud initiatives. This is where you define what you're trying to accomplish with cloud services and why these initiatives matter to your organization.
During this stage, you'll conduct a thorough assessment of your current IT environment, identifying which applications and services would benefit from cloud migration. As noted by cloud implementation specialists at Future Processing, a critical first step is performing a comprehensive current state analysis of existing IT services before any migration decisions are made.
This stage also involves defining clear business objectives for your cloud initiative. Are you seeking cost reduction, increased agility, or access to new capabilities? Your answers will shape the entire lifecycle approach. Decision-makers must align cloud strategy with broader organizational goals to ensure the technology serves the business rather than existing in isolation.
Financial modeling is another crucial component of this phase. Teams develop TCO (Total Cost of Ownership) models that project expenses across the service lifetime, helping to establish budgets and ROI expectations.
Service Design
Once strategic directions are established, the design phase translates these goals into actionable technical plans. This stage focuses on creating detailed architectures that specify how cloud services will be constructed, secured, and integrated.
Architects must determine the appropriate cloud model - public, private, hybrid, or multi-cloud - based on workload requirements, compliance needs, and organizational constraints. Security architecture receives particular attention during this phase, with teams designing identity management, encryption, network security controls, and compliance mechanisms.
Design documents will also specify performance requirements, availability targets, and disaster recovery capabilities. Teams define SLAs (Service Level Agreements) that establish measurable quality targets for the service once it's operational.
Resource planning during this phase includes capacity planning, determining scaling parameters, and establishing monitoring requirements. These decisions significantly impact both performance and cost management downstream.
Service Transition
The transition phase bridges the gap between design and operation. During this critical stage, theoretical plans become functioning cloud environments through careful implementation and testing.
This phase typically includes build activities where infrastructure is provisioned according to design specifications. Modern approaches leverage Infrastructure as Code (IaC) to automate this process, creating repeatable and version-controlled deployments.
Testing forms a significant component of transition, with teams validating functionality, performance, security, and compliance before releasing services to users. Migration activities occur during this phase for existing workloads moving to the cloud, often following careful sequencing to minimize disruption.
Training and knowledge transfer ensure operational teams understand how to manage the new service effectively. Documentation created during this phase becomes a valuable reference throughout the service lifecycle.
Service Operation
The operation phase represents the day-to-day management of cloud services after deployment. During this longest lifecycle stage, teams focus on maintaining service quality while controlling costs.
Incident management processes detect, diagnose, and resolve service disruptions to minimize impact on users. Problem management identifies and addresses underlying causes of recurring incidents. Change management governs modifications to the service, ensuring they're properly tested and don't introduce new risks.
Performance monitoring tracks resource utilization, response times, and other metrics against established SLAs. Cost management activities identify optimization opportunities and prevent cloud spending from exceeding budgets.
Security operations during this phase include vulnerability management, threat monitoring, and incident response to protect cloud assets from emerging threats.
Continuous Improvement
As explained by cloud management specialists at Certes, effective cloud strategies must prioritize continuous improvement to ensure long-term success. This phase isn't sequential but operates alongside all other phases, creating a feedback loop that drives ongoing enhancement.
Teams regularly review performance data, user feedback, and industry developments to identify improvement opportunities. They track technology trends that might impact the service, such as new cloud provider capabilities or emerging security threats.
Regular service reviews compare actual performance against targets and business expectations. Cost optimization activities identify resourced that are underutilized or could benefit from newer pricing models or instance types.
These five stages - strategy, design, transition, operation, and improvement - don't function as a strict linear sequence but rather as an interconnected cycle. Each stage feeds into the next while continuous improvement connects back to all stages, creating a dynamic framework that adapts to changing business needs and technological capabilities. By understanding these stages and their relationships, organizations can more effectively manage their cloud services throughout the complete lifecycle.
Managing Cloud Platform Operations
Operational excellence in cloud platforms requires systematic approaches that balance performance, cost, and security. With the rapid evolution of cloud technologies, operations management has become both more powerful and more complex. Let's examine the key components of effective cloud platform operations management.
Automation: The Foundation of Modern Operations
Automation stands at the heart of efficient cloud operations. Manual processes simply cannot scale to meet the demands of modern cloud environments. According to IT management experts at Virima, automating repetitive cloud operations—such as provisioning, backups, and network monitoring—not only boosts efficiency and reduces human error but also enables IT teams to shift focus toward more strategic projects.
Resource provisioning automation ensures new resources deploy with consistent configurations. Auto-scaling capabilities respond to changing workload demands without manual intervention. Configuration management tools maintain system states and prevent configuration drift across large environments.
Network automation specialists at Lansweeper note that leveraging automation for network configuration and provisioning significantly reduces manual intervention, accelerates deployment times, and helps maintain consistent cloud operations at scale.
Patch management automation applies security updates consistently across environments, reducing vulnerability windows. Backup and recovery processes execute on schedule without human involvement, ensuring data protection requirements are consistently met.
Monitoring and Observability
Effective cloud operations require comprehensive visibility into system behavior and performance. Monitoring tools track resource utilization, application performance, and user experience metrics. Modern approaches go beyond simple metric collection to embrace observability, the ability to understand internal system states based on external outputs.
Log aggregation centralizes log data from distributed systems, making troubleshooting more efficient. Distributed tracing tracks requests as they flow through microservices architectures, identifying bottlenecks and performance issues. Synthetic monitoring simulates user interactions to detect problems before real users encounter them.
Dashboards provide visual representations of system health, allowing operations teams to identify trends and anomalies quickly. Alerting systems notify teams when metrics exceed thresholds, enabling proactive response to potential issues.
Configuration and Change Management
As cloud environments grow, keeping track of configurations becomes increasingly challenging. A centralized Configuration Management Database (CMDB) provides a single source of truth for managing assets and services, streamlining change tracking, compliance, and operational control in cloud environments.
Version control systems track infrastructure and configuration changes, enabling rollback when needed. Change approval processes ensure modifications undergo appropriate review before implementation. Impact analysis helps teams understand potential consequences of proposed changes before executing them.
Configuration validation tools verify that environments match desired states, preventing unauthorized or accidental modifications. Configuration as code approaches treat infrastructure configurations as software, applying software development best practices to infrastructure management.
Incident and Problem Management
Even in well-managed environments, incidents occur. Effective incident management processes detect issues quickly, restore service promptly, and minimize user impact.
Incident response playbooks provide step-by-step guidance for addressing common scenarios. Automated remediation capabilities fix known issues without human intervention. Post-incident reviews analyze what happened, why it happened, and how to prevent recurrence.
Problem management focuses on identifying and addressing root causes of recurring incidents. This proactive approach prevents issues rather than simply responding to them. Knowledge management systems capture lessons learned, making teams more effective over time.
Cost Management and Optimization
Cloud billing models offer flexibility but can lead to unexpected costs without proper management. Cost visibility tools provide granular insights into spending patterns across teams and services. Resource tagging strategies enable cost allocation to appropriate business units or projects.
Right-sizing efforts ensure resources match actual requirements rather than over-provisioning. Reserved instance purchases reduce costs for predictable workloads. Lifecycle policies automatically manage data storage tiers, moving infrequently accessed data to less expensive storage options.
Automated scheduling stops development and test environments during inactive periods. Orphaned resource detection identifies and removes unused assets that continue generating costs. Regular cost reviews identify optimization opportunities and track progress against spending targets.
By integrating these operational practices, organizations can maintain reliable, secure, and cost-effective cloud environments that support business objectives while adapting to changing requirements. The key lies in building systems that minimize manual effort, provide comprehensive visibility, and continuously optimize based on actual usage patterns.
Also read: Top 98 DevOps Tools to Look Out for in 2025
Optimizing Cloud Strategies for Success
As cloud technologies mature and economic pressures intensify, organizations must shift from simple cloud adoption to sophisticated optimization. This evolution requires strategic thinking about how cloud resources are utilized, managed, and integrated into broader business objectives.
Economic Imperatives for Cloud Optimization
The economic landscape is reshaping cloud strategies across industries. According to Gartner, 61% of CEOs anticipate continued inflation and low growth in 2025, making cloud optimization not merely a technical exercise but a business imperative. Organizations are increasingly focusing on resetting strategies for long-term growth and digital transformation while carefully managing costs.
This economic reality coincides with explosive growth in cloud spending. Gartner projections cited by Upland Software indicate that global spending on cloud services will rise from $595.7 billion in 2024 to $723.4 billion in 2025, with 81% of IT leaders increasing their cloud budgets specifically to support AI workloads. This combination of economic caution and increasing cloud investment necessitates more sophisticated optimization approaches.
Strategic Approaches to Cloud Optimization
Effective cloud optimization begins with business alignment. Every cloud decision should support specific business outcomes rather than focusing solely on technical capabilities. This alignment ensures that optimization efforts contribute directly to organizational goals.
A data-driven approach uses performance metrics and usage patterns to guide decisions. By establishing baselines and tracking trends, teams can identify optimization opportunities objectively rather than relying on assumptions. Regular architecture reviews evaluate whether current implementations remain optimal as business requirements and cloud capabilities evolve.
Cloud experts at OpsGuru recommend following a lifecycle approach with three key stages: Provisioning, Optimization, and Deprovisioning. This structured method enables organizations to intentionally manage each phase for maximum efficiency.
Technical Optimization Tactics
Resource right-sizing matches computing resources to actual workload requirements. This process identifies over-provisioned resources and adjusts them to appropriate levels, often reducing costs by 20-40%. Automated scaling ensures resources expand during peak demands and contract during quiet periods, optimizing both performance and cost.
Storage tier optimization moves data between performance tiers based on access patterns. Frequently accessed data remains on high-performance storage while rarely accessed data transitions to lower-cost options. Data lifecycle policies automate this movement, ensuring optimal cost-performance balance without manual intervention.
Network optimization focuses on data transfer costs, which often surprise organizations with their magnitude. Techniques include content delivery networks for frequently accessed content, data compression to reduce transfer volumes, and careful planning of cross-region traffic to minimize expensive data movement.
Financial Optimization Practices
Reserved capacity commitments provide significant discounts for predictable workloads. By committing to specific usage levels for 1-3 years, organizations can reduce costs by 30-75% compared to on-demand pricing. Spot instances leverage unused cloud provider capacity at steep discounts for non-critical, interruptible workloads.
Chargeback and showback models allocate cloud costs to appropriate business units, creating accountability and encouraging efficient resource use. When teams see the direct financial impact of their cloud usage decisions, they naturally optimize their consumption patterns.
License optimization ensures software licenses align with cloud deployment models. Many traditional licensing models aren't designed for cloud elasticity, creating opportunities to restructure agreements for significant savings.
Organizational and Process Optimization
Successful cloud optimization requires cross-functional collaboration. FinOps practices bring together finance, technology, and business teams to make data-driven decisions about cloud resources. This collaborative approach ensures technical decisions reflect business priorities and financial realities.
Continuous education keeps teams current on evolving cloud capabilities and optimization techniques. Cloud providers constantly introduce new services and pricing models that may enable further optimization. Regular reviews against industry benchmarks help identify whether cloud costs and performance align with peer organizations.
Automation of optimization processes ensures consistent application of best practices. Automated policies can enforce tagging standards, shut down development environments during off-hours, and alert teams to anomalous usage patterns that may indicate optimization opportunities.
By adopting these comprehensive optimization approaches, organizations can extract maximum value from their cloud investments while controlling costs. In an environment where economic pressures and technology opportunities both continue to intensify, optimization isn't a one-time project but an ongoing discipline that evolves with business needs and cloud capabilities.
Frequently Asked Questions
What is the cloud service lifecycle?
The cloud service lifecycle refers to the complete journey of a cloud service from inception to retirement, encompassing phases such as strategy, design, transition, operation, and continuous improvement to maximize value and minimize risks.
Why is automation important in cloud operations?
Automation enhances efficiency by streamlining repetitive tasks such as provisioning, monitoring, and backups. This reduces human error and allows IT teams to focus on more strategic initiatives.
What are the key phases of the cloud service lifecycle?
The key phases include Service Strategy, Service Design, Service Transition, Service Operation, and Continuous Improvement, each playing a critical role in effective cloud management.
How can organizations optimize their cloud strategies for success?
Organizations can optimize their cloud strategies by aligning cloud initiatives with business goals, employing a data-driven approach to identify optimization opportunities, and fostering collaboration across finance, tech, and business teams.
Propel Your Cloud Strategy to New Heights with Amnic
In the quest to master the cloud service lifecycle, organizations often find themselves grappling with escalating costs and complex resource management. The article emphasizes the importance of continuous improvement and strategic cost management in navigating cloud services effectively. But what if you could eliminate wasted resources and gain real-time insights into your cloud spending?
At Amnic, we specialize in cloud cost observability, empowering you to visualize and optimize your cloud expenses effortlessly. Say goodbye to unexpected cost overruns and hello to tailored optimization practices designed for your specific needs. With tools for anomaly detection, granular reporting, and actionable alerts, your team can swiftly identify and resolve inefficiencies, transforming your cloud environment from a source of concern into a strategic advantage.
Book a Personalized Demo | Get a 30-Day No Cost Trial